What are the differences between rosemary and tomatillos?
- Rosemary is higher in iron, vitamin A, fiber, calcium, folate, copper, vitamin B6, and magnesium, yet tomatillos are higher in manganese.
- Tomatillos' daily need coverage for manganese is 6610% more.
- Rosemary has 45 times more calcium than tomatillos. While rosemary has 317mg of calcium, tomatillos have only 7mg.
- The amount of saturated fat in tomatillos is lower.
We used Rosemary, fresh and Tomatillos, raw types in this article.
